Cold Shop rental includes

  • 24" diamond / pre-polish lap wheel with 60 grit, 140 grit, 270 grit, 325 grit, 600 grit, and cerium discs

  • 2 Cerium polishing wheels ( cerium is included in cold shop rental)

  • 104" vertical wet belt sander with round rubber roller platen with 40 grit, 60 grit, 80 grit, 120 grit, 220 grit, 400 grit, 600 grit, and cork belts

  • Covington Lathe with one arbor and 1 in diameter spindle:  4 in Radiused wheels - 60 grit, 100 grit, 180 grit, 360 grit, and 600 grit wheels and 6 in Radiused wheels: 80 grit, 100 grit, 180 grit, and 360 grit wheels, 3 size cerium wheels

  •  Husqvarna tile saw with 12" and 13.5" diamond saws

  • Diamond coring drill press

  • 220 grit sandblaster

  • Foredom flex shaft with foot pedal and diamonds bits
